Louise Da-Cocodia Education Trust (L.D.E.T) We use community-based research to deliver programmes that help children, young people and adults of African and Caribbean heritage to get ahead and achieve their ambitions. We tackle issues and identify gaps to remove barriers to education, training or employment.

CHARM Communities for Holistic Accessible Rights based Mental Health We are a campaign calling for changes in the way psychiatric services are provided in Greater Manchester. We’ve teamed up with people with lived experience, workers, trade unions, family groups and citizens We are calling for a root and branch review and an action plan to transform mental health services in our communities.

T.A.P. Project seeks to promote social inclusion for the public benefit by working with people of African origin and African Diaspora in Manchester, the United Kingdom and globally who are socially excluded.

CAHN is a Black-led organisation set up to address the wider social determinants to eradicate health disparities for Caribbean & African people in the United Kingdom. We work with the Black community and cross-sector organisations to build community resilience, relationships, and a social movement to improve health outcomes for Black people.

What is GMCVO? GMCVO is the voluntary, community and social enterprise (VCSE) sector support and development organisation ('infrastructure') covering the Greater Manchester (GM) city region. We work with and through the voluntary, community and social enterprise (VCSE) sector for the benefit of the people and communities of Greater Manchester
